I have both of your choices. I got one for one son and one for the other son when they turned 16. Both .270 stainless with black plastic stocks. I use theirs. Sold mine because we never use three rifles in one day.
Anyway we all trade the Rem and Ruger back and forth and nobody has a preference. Remington action seems a tad bit smoother, but both have had shells stuck a time or two. There is NO difference at the range.
I prefer three-position visible safety on the Ruger.
So my opinion is go for the cheaper of the two and put the saved money in the scope. Our Remington was about $100 more.
